The CHAA dues go towards supporting a variety of causes.
These causes include:
1) The Partner With Youth Campaign. This YMCA of Central
Massachusetts fund raiser raises over 400,000 annually to ensure
that families in central Massachusetts can afford camp and
childcare.
2) YMCA Camp Harrington's "Camp Improvement Fund." This
fund, supported by Camp Families & Alumni, raises between
5,000 and 8,000 annually. All the money goes directly towards
improvements needed for Camp Harrington and the CHAA Board
of Directors and Facility Advisory Group meet (with the Camp
Director) to allocate how funds are spent each year
3) The Camp Harrington Scholarship Fund (starting in 2007)
supports mini-grants of 250 to 500 to 1000 dollars for camp alumni
in college or professionally. Applications (and criteria for
eligibility) for the Scholarships will be made available in the
Summer of 2007 and the 1st Scholarships will be handed out in
January of 2008 at the 1st Annual Camp Awards/Reunion Dinner
at the Greendale YMCA.
4) Staff Appreciation Fund. This was started in 2002 to help
parents that may want to do something special for camp staff (tips
are against YMCA policy). They can now make a donation to a
general fund that is used to support the Annual August Formal
Staff Dinner and provide staff with a CD, a Puzzle Piece (camp
tradition started in 2006), door prizes, and the host family a thank
you gift)
